Navigating Nuclear Power and the Voices of Hiroshima Survivors

This chapter explores the dual role of nuclear power as a low-carbon energy solution amid climate change, while addressing the inherent risks and the need for infrastructure improvements. It also features poignant stories from atomic bomb survivors, known as hibakusha, shedding light on the enduring health impacts of the Manhattan Project.
